Kanye West has responded to Kid Cudi’s string of tweets blasting him and other rappers such as Drake as “the fake ones”, by launching into an onstage rant against Cudi while performing a gig in Tampa, Florida on Wednesday (September 14th).

“Kid Cudi, don't ever mention 'Ye name. I birthed you,” he says in a fan video doing the rounds. “We all dealing with that emo shit all the time… Don't ever mention 'Ye name. Don't try to say who I can do songs with. You mad 'cause I'm doing songs with Drake? Ain't nobody telling 'Ye who to do songs with! Respect the God!”

39 year old Kanye signed Kid Cudi to his G.O.O.D. Music label back in 2008, releasing three albums on the imprint before leaving to form his own label in 2013.

The rapper has also continued to work with Kanye, last appearing on The Life of Pablo’s track ‘Father Stretch My Hands’ – but it looks as though any future collabs might be off the table after this latest exchange.

“You know how many people wish they could be signed to G.O.O.D. Music, get they life changed? Have that opportunity? Never forget that. I'm so hurt. I feel so disrespected,” Kanye continued.

“Kid Cudi, we're two black men in a racist world. I wore skinny jeans first. I got called names before you, bruh. Why y'all got to come at me? This ain't the end of the Malcolm X movie. I'm out here fighting for y'all: creatives, artists, independent thinkers. Don’t never mention my name in a bad manner. None of y’all!”

32 year old Cudi, who is preparing his sixth studio album for release by the end of 2016, had unleashed a string of tweets earlier on Wednesday. “I've been loyal to those who haven't been to me and that ends now. Now I'm your threat.”

He then called out Drake and Kanye specifically, adding: “These n***as don’t give a f*** about me. And they ain’t f***in with me.”
